Amy Grant & Vince Gill Share Their 25-Year Love Story: A Journey of Faith, Music, and Enduring Love

Amy Grant and Vince Gill, two of country and contemporary Christian music’s most beloved artists, have a love story that spans over 25 years—one marked by deep connection, shared faith, and mutual admiration. Their journey from colleagues to soulmates has inspired fans around the world and continues to stand as a testament to lasting love in the often turbulent world of fame and entertainment.

Their story began in the early 1990s, when Amy and Vince first met while collaborating on music projects. At the time, both were married to other people—Amy to Christian singer Gary Chapman and Vince to country singer Janis Oliver. Their initial connection was purely professional, but even then, friends and collaborators noticed a unique chemistry between them.

Over time, that bond deepened. They began to perform together more often, their harmonies blending effortlessly, their stage presence natural and warm. In interviews, both have reflected on how they felt drawn to each other, not just through music, but through shared values and a deep emotional understanding.

In 1999, after both of their marriages ended, Amy and Vince took the step from friendship to romance. They married in 2000, in a quiet, heartfelt ceremony that marked the beginning of a new chapter. Despite the scrutiny they faced from the media and some fans, they remained steadfast in their commitment to each other.

Over the years, their love has only grown stronger. Amy has spoken openly about how Vince supported her through some of her most difficult moments, including health challenges and family changes. Vince, in turn, has often described Amy as his rock—someone whose grace and strength ground him both personally and professionally.

Their blended family, which includes Amy’s three children from her previous marriage and their daughter together, Corrina, has become a central part of their life. Family, faith, and music are at the heart of everything they do. They continue to perform together regularly, especially during their beloved annual Christmas shows at the Ryman Auditorium in Nashville—an event that has become a cherished tradition for many.

In recent years, Amy faced a serious health scare after undergoing open-heart surgery in 2020 and later recovering from a traumatic bicycle accident in 2022. Throughout it all, Vince stood by her side, offering unwavering love and support. Their journey through these trials has only highlighted the depth of their bond.
